M-1 · Dandridge, TN14-411. M-1, Light Industrial D istrict. The M-1, Light Industrial District is established to p rovide areas for warehousi ng, manufacturing, and similar light industrial uses. The following regulations shall apply: 1. Uses Permitted. a. Commercial laundry. b. Outdoor equipment storage lots and yards except for wrecking, junk, or salvage yards. c. Communication facilities. d. Public utilities. e. Wholesale trade. f. Retail trade such as building materials, hardware, and farm equipment. g. Warehousing and storage services. h. Food and kindred products manufacturing not including meat products. Manufacturing i. Textile mill products manufacturing. j. Agricultural processing not including slaughterhouses or meat 62 packaging. k. Apparel and other finished products manufacturing made from fabrics and similar materials. Materials l. Furniture and fixtures manufacturing. m. Printing, publishing, and allied industries. n. Stone, clay, and glass products manufacturing. o. Professional, scientific, and controlling instruments manufacturing. p. Small article manufacturing - jewelry, musical instruments, toys, pens, pencils. Any use or structure customarily incidental to the above uses. q. Freighting or trucking yards r. Communications Towers s. Public Buildings owned by a governmental entity or a non-profit organization. 2. Special Exceptions. Any use which, in the opinion of the board of zoning appeals, would be of the same character as the above and could not de stroy the intent of the code will be permitted: a. Communication Towers b. Adult Oriented Businesses c. TATTOO Parlors, provided: 1). Tattoo parlors provided that the building where the principal use is established is located a minimum of one -thousand (1,000) feet from any public school, church, and/or daycare center. 2). The maximum sign area does not exceed twenty (20) square feet in area and meets all requirements of Section 14-604. 3). Obtaining a Busin ess License, a Health Department Permit and continued compliance with the conditions se t for th in the Special Use Permit that is issued. 4). Compliance with all applicable requ irements of Section 62 -38-201 through 62 -38-210 of the Tennessee Code Annotated. (per ordinance 08/09-11) d. Methadone and Pain Management Clinics provided: 1). Obtaining a Business License, a valid Certification by the State o f Tennessee Health Departm ent, compliance with all applic able requirements of the Dandridge Municipal Code and continued compliance with the conditions set forth in the Special Use Permit that is issued; 2).
